
Shahganj to Bathinda
Bathinda is approximately 900+ kms from Shahganj. The fastest way to reach Bathinda from Shahganj is by Train, Flight Via Ayodhya, Delhi. It takes approximately 6 hours. The cheapest way to reach Bathinda from Shahganj is by Train Via Rampur (Uttar Pradesh) which would take approximately 19 hours.
Sort By
Mode of Transport
Via Ayodhya, Delhi
RECOMMENDED
FASTEST
Shahganj
Ayodhya
Delhi
Bathinda
Approx Travel Time
6h 5m
₹9,913
Onwards
Via Varanasi, Delhi
Shahganj
Varanasi
Delhi
Bathinda
Approx Travel Time
6h 48m
₹9,625
Onwards
Via Ayodhya, Hisar
Shahganj
Ayodhya
Hisar
Bathinda
Approx Travel Time
7h 57m
₹3,866
Onwards
Via Rampur (Uttar Pradesh)
CHEAPEST
Shahganj
Rampur (Uttar Pradesh)
Bathinda
Approx Travel Time
19h 14m
₹610
Onwards
Via Yamunanagar
Shahganj
Yamunanagar
Bathinda
Approx Travel Time
21h 11m
₹5,393
Onwards
Via Rajpura
Shahganj
Rajpura
Bathinda
Approx Travel Time
21h 58m
₹984
Onwards
Via Robertsganj, Lucknow
Shahganj
Robertsganj
Lucknow
Bathinda
Approx Travel Time
1d 7h
On Demand
Via Varanasi, Ghaziabad
Shahganj
Varanasi
Ghaziabad
Bathinda
Approx Travel Time
7h 3m
₹8,923
Onwards
Via Gorakhpur, Delhi
Shahganj
Gorakhpur
Delhi
Bathinda
Approx Travel Time
7h
On Demand
Frequently Asked Questions
What is the distance between Shahganj and Bathinda?
Bathinda is approximately 900+ kms from Shahganj.
How long does it take to reach Bathinda from Shahganj?
It takes approximately 6 hours to reach Bathinda from Shahganj by Train, Flight Via Ayodhya, Delhi.
What is the cheapest way to reach Bathinda from Shahganj?
The cheapest way to reach Bathinda from Shahganj is by Train Via Rampur (Uttar Pradesh).
What is the fastest way to reach Bathinda from Shahganj?
The fastest way to reach Bathinda from Shahganj is by Train, Flight Via Ayodhya, Delhi.
Routes Connecting Shahganj
Routes From Shahganj
- Shahganj to Karjat
- Shahganj to Pondicherry
- Shahganj to Kasganj
- Shahganj to Chandrapur
- Shahganj to Saharanpur
- Shahganj to Tuljapur
- Shahganj to Titilagarh
- Shahganj to Tandur
- Shahganj to Hagaribommanahalli
- Shahganj to Sirkazhi
- Shahganj to Darbhanga
- Shahganj to Dabwali
- Shahganj to Moga
- Shahganj to Samba
- Shahganj to Kangra
Routes To Shahganj
Routes Connecting Bathinda
Routes From Bathinda
Routes To Bathinda
- Dwarka to Bathinda
- Nabadwip to Bathinda
- Gauribidanur to Bathinda
- Kanigiri to Bathinda
- Kharagpur to Bathinda
- Gopalganj to Bathinda
- Amritsar to Bathinda
- Ambaji to Bathinda
- Bhilwara to Bathinda
- Musafirkhana to Bathinda
- Sultanpur to Bathinda
- Mandya to Bathinda
- Malappuram to Bathinda
- Morbi to Bathinda
- Dharmapuri to Bathinda


